Quality education must for country’s progress: PM

Submitted by Rubab Saleem on December 11, 2007 – 8:05 pmNo Comment

TALAGANG: Prime Minister Muhammadmian Soomro has said that quality education is imperative to face the present day challenges and for progress and prosperity of the country. Performing ground breaking ceremony of Makkah Cadet College being constructed in private sector here on Tuesday, he said that the government is committed to root out illiteracy and huge amounts are being spent for the promotion of education. He said equal attention is being given on the primary and higher education.

He urged the private sector to supplement the government’s efforts in promotion of education in the country. He also emphasized for maintaining high standards in all sectors of social services particularly in education and health. Soomro appreciated the services of Makkah family for establishing the Cadet College in far flung area for the promotion of education.

The Prime Minister also announced the construction of two link roads in the areas on the demand of the local people. Earlier, Managing Director Makkah System of Education, Malik Ghulam Sarwar thanked the Prime Minister for his visit. He said the institution is being constructed on 30 kanals of land and will provide quality education to about 2000 children.-SANA
